Solvent-water-2-propanol 삼성분계의 액-액평형 (LLE of Solvent-Water-2-Propanol Ternary Systems)

  • 에너지 비용의 상승에 따라 추출의 기본원리를 둔 새로운 분리공정에 대한 연구가 많이 진행되고 있으며, 이에 따라 액-액평형 조성의 계산 및 예측에 대한 필요성이 매우 증가하고 있다. 본 연구에서는 공비혼합물을 형성하는 2-propanol 수용액에 용매로서 methyl ethyl ketone, methyl isobutyl ketone, ethylacetate, butylacetate, toluene 및 o-xylene을 첨가한 삼성분계에 대하여 $25^{\circ}C$에서 용해도곡선, tie line, plait point, 분배계수와 선택도를 실험을 통해 구하였다. Tie line 데이터의열역학적 건전성을 확인하였으며 실험값을 NRTL 및 UNIQUAC 모델식으로 구한 계산값과 비교하였다.

전.자계상의 전원장치변화에 따른 비열방전 플라즈마의 $SO_2$와 CO가스 제거특성 ($SO_2$ and CO Removal Characteristics in Various Applied Voltage of Nonthermal Discharge Plasma in a Crossed DC Magnetic Field)

  • $SO_2$and CO gas removal characteristics of a wire-to-cylinder type nonthermal discharge plasma reactor in various applied voltage (-dc, ac, fast rising pulse and high frequency pulse) and a crossed dc magnetic field have been investigated. The experiment has been emphasized on the oxidizing characteristics of $SO_2$ and CO gas by $O_3$ and the applying of a crossed magnetic field, which would induce the cyclotronic and drift motions of electrons making the residual time longer in the removal airgap space. And it also would enhance the energy of electrons and the electrophysicochemical actions to remove the pollutant gases effectively. It is found thatthe corona onset voltage and the breakdown voltage were decreased with increasing the crossed magnetic field and decrease initial fed $SO_2$and CO concentration. As a result, a higher ozone generation and $SO_2$ and CO gas removal rate of 20[%] can be obtained with -dc, ac and fast rising pulse corona discharges in the crossed dc current-induced magnetic field. But high frequency pulse didn't show effect in applying of a crossed magnetic field.

근적외선 반사분광분석법에 의한 정육 및 그 구성성분의 반사 spectra에 관한 연구 (Studies on the Near Infrared Diffuse Reflection Spectroscopy for Meat Components)

  • 이 연구의 목적은 식품성분의 분석을 위한 신속간편법으로 근적외선 반사 분광분석을 이용함에 있어 흡광도에 영향을 미치는 시료의 물리적, 화학적 요인을 규명하고자 한다. 온도를 달리한 정육시료를 근적외선 파장 범위인 $1100{\sim}2500\;nm$에서 흡광도를 측정한 결과 온도가 상승함에 따라 흡광도가 대체로 증가하였다. 시료의 세절시간이 길어질수록 흡광도는 감소하였다. 정육, 육단백질, 지방 및 수분의 근적외선 스펙트럼에서 나타난 흡수띠는 분자내의 C-H, N-H, O-H 및 C=O 결합의 overtone과 combination 진동에 의한 것으로 확인되었다. 정육 구성성분 중 육단백질의 흡광도가 가장 낮았으며 지방은 1700 nm와 2300 nm 부근에서 특징적인 ${\cdot}CH_2{\cdot}$ 흡수띠를 보였고 1450 nm와 1930 nm에서 물분자에 의한 강한 흡수띠가 나타났다. 결과적으로 정육의 근적외선 스펙트럼의 흡광도는 함유된 수분과 지방에 의한 영향을 많이 받는 것으로 사료된다.

P/N-CTR 코드를 사용한 SSN과 누화 잡음 감소 I/O 인터페이스 방식 (The SSN and Crosstalk Noise Reduction I/O Interface Scheme Using the P/N-CTR Code)

  • 칩과 칩 사이의 전송 속도가 증가함에 따라, 누화 및 스위칭 잡음에 의한 시스템의 성능 저하가 심각해지고 있다. 본 논문에서 제안하는 인터페이스는 한 심벌 펄스의 상승/하강 에지 위치에 데이터를 엔코딩하고, 천이 방향이 반대인 P-CTR과 N-CTR (positive/Negative Constant Transition Rate)을 사용하며, P-CTR 드라이버 2개 묶음과 N-CTR 드라이버 2개 묶음을 교대로 배치하여 버스를 구성한다. 제안하는 P/N-CTR 코드 인터페이스에서는 임의의 한 배선에 대해서 양옆의 이웃한 배선 신호가 동시에 같은 방향으로 스위칭하는 경우가 발생하지 않기 때문에 최대 누화 잡음과 최대 스위칭 잡음을 기존의 I/O 인테페이스 보다 감소시킬 수 있다. 제안하는 인터페이스 방식의 잡음 감소 특성을 검증하기 위하여 다양한 배선 구조와 여러 비트 폭의 버스 구조에 적용하고, 0.35㎛ SPICE 파라미터를 이용한 HSPICE 시뮬레이션을 수행하였다. 제안한 인터페이스는 기존의 인터페이스와 비교하여 32 비트 미만의 버스에서는 최대 누화 잡음이 최소26.78 % 감소하고, 누화는 50 % 감소한다.

The radiation shielding proficiency and hyperspectral-based spatial distribution of lateritic terrain mapping in Irikkur block, Kannur, Kerala

  • The practice of identifying the potential zones for mineral exploration in a speedy and low-cost method includes the use of satellite imagery analysis as a part of remote sensing techniques. It is challenging to explore the iron mineralization of a region through conventional methods which are a time-consuming process. The current study utilizes the Hyperion satellite imagery for mapping the iron mineralization and associated geological features in the Irikkur region, Kannur, Kerala. Along with the remote sensing results, the field study and laboratory-based analysis were conducted to retrieve the ground truth point and geochemical proportion to verify the iron ore mineralization. The MC simulation showed for shielding properties indicate an increase in the linear attenuation coefficient with raising the Fe2O3+SiO2 concentrations in the investigated rocks where it is varied at 0.662 MeV in the range 0.190 cm-1 - 0.222 cm-1 with rising the Fe2O3+SiO2 content from 57.86 wt% to 71.15 wt%. The analysis also revealed that when the γ-ray energy increased from 0.221 MeV to 2.506 MeV, sample 1 had the largest linear attenuation coefficient, ranging from 9.33 cm1 to 0.12 cm-1. Charnockite rocks were found to have exceptional shielding qualities, making them an excellent natural choice for radiation shielding applications.

국내휘발유 승용차량으로부터의 N2O배출인자 특성연구 (Characteristics of N2O Emission Factor and Measurements from Gasoline-Powered Passenger Vehicles)

  • Nitrous oxide ($N_2O$) is an important trace gas in the atmosphere not only because of its large global warming potential (GWP) but also because of the role in the ozone depletion in the stratosphere. It has been known that soil is the largest natural source of $N_2O$ in global emission. However, anthropogenic sources contributing from industrial section is likely to increase with rising the energy consumption, and transportation as well. In this study, a total of 32 gasoline-powered passenger vehicles (ranging from small to large engine's displacement and also ranging from aged catalyst to new catalyst) were tested on the chassis dynamometer system in order to elucidate the characteristics of $N_2O$ emission from automobiles under different driving modes. Ten different driving modes developed by NIER were adapted for the test. The results show that the $N_2O$ emission decreases logarithmically with increase of vehicle speed over the all test vehicles ($N_2O$) emission = -0.062 Ln (vehicle speed) + $0.289,\;r^2=0.97$). It revealed that the larger engine's displacement, the more $N_2O$ emission were recorded. The correlation between $N_2O$ emission and catalyst aging was examined. It found that the vehicles with aged catalyst (odometer record more than 8,0000km) emit more $N_2O$ than those with new catalyst. Average $N_2O$ emission was $0.086{\pm}0.095\;N_2O-g/km$ (number of samples=210) for the all test vehicles over the test driving modes.

원환형 덮개장착이 스피너 장비의 기류에 미치는 영향 (EFFECTS OF PLACEMENT OF A TORUS PLATE COVER ON AIR FLOW IN A SPINNER EQUIPMENT)

  • A numerical investigation is made of air flow in a spinner equipment used for cleanning and drying flat display panels. A unique feature of the spinner under question is the placement of a torus plate cover over the rotating plate. The turbulent flow is driven by rotation of a large disk and suction by the exhaust system connected to vacuum chamber. The flow is modelled as an axisymmetric two-dimensional flow and computation is conducted by using the FLUENT package with a version of k-$\varepsilon$ turbulence model. The required capacity of the exhaust system is assessed numerically. The usefulness of the cover in controlling air flow circulation is examined. A computational trouble shooting is attempted to resolve the problem of panel rising which occurred in real experiment.

사용자 요구에 의한 갤러리 리노베이션 방안에 관한 연구 - 수도권 A, K, R갤러리의 사례분석을 중심으로 - (A study on the renovation of gallery by the P.O.E - Focus on the case study of A, K, R gallery in the National Capital region -)

  • Internationally, Korean people and society are known to be workaholic, however, recently some changes have come with the inauguration of the 5 working-days system as well as the rising of economic power and high level of education. Many people come to enjoy leisure time with various activities. Especially, arts become the subject of concern as a kind of leisure life, and also gallery become a important space. However, the renovation of the gallery space is required Inevitably because many galleries have been located in too formal or fixed building space, and the management of it has not been executed thoroughly. This study aims at the suggestion of the specialized and differentiated renovation plan for gallery as cultural space offering the right notion and information about the arts as well as rest to citizens, also as exhibit space showing the object efficiently.

DPF 성능 평가를 위한 Dump Combustor의 활용 (The Application of Dump Combustor for Evaluation of DPF(Diesel Particulate Filter) System)

  • The number of vehicles employing diesel engines is rapidly rising. Accompanying this trend, application of an after-treatment system is strictly required as a result of reinforced exhaust regulations. The Diesel Particulate Filter (DPF) system is considered as the most efficient method to reduce particulate matter (PM), but the improvement of a regeneration performance at any engine operation point presents a considerable challenge by itself. Temperature, gas compostion and flow rate of exhaust gas are important parameters in DPF evaluation, especially regeneration process. Engine dynamometer and degment tester are generally used in DPF evaluation so far. But these test method couldn't reveal the effect of various parameters on real DPF, such as O2 concentration, amount of soot and exhaust gas temperature. This research has studied the possibility using dump combustor that used to take an approach lean premixed combustion in gas turbine for a DPF power and optimized. It is possible that utilize the system as DOC (Diesel Oxidation Catalyst) and SCR(Selective Catalytic Reduction) assessments test as well as DPF evaluation

ABS/AES 블렌드의 물성에 관한 연구 (Studies on the Properties of ABS/AES Blonds)

  • In this work, properties of ABS/AES blends were investigated. Blends were prepared by casting from THF. The thermal stability, light resistance, storage modulus and flame retardancy were measured by thermogravimetric analysis, cole. difference in Fade-o-meter, Rheovibron, and limiting oxygen index(LOI). The thermal stability, light resistance and storage modulus increased with increasing contents of AES. ABS and AES showed similar LOI. The LOI of the ABS/AES blends increased with rising contents of AES but all the blends were found to be flammable. It was observed that ABS and AES was incompatible from the morphology by scanning electron microscope(SEM).
